Physical-Mechanical Model of Fibrous Polymerized Bar Deformation at the Neck Zone
In the paper the author suggests a model of mechanical deformation of a polymerized bar made of fibres in the neck with regard to forces interacting with a matrix. In the paper, the author suggests an experimental-theoretical method that allows one to define the character of deformation non-homogeneity in the neck area. In particular, analytic dependence of mechanical properties of the material on longitudinal coordinate of the sample is established. Numerical comparison of theoretical results with experimental ones is given.
